Maximizing Your Jewelry Cabinet: The Role of Velvet Lined Drawers
Introduction: The Importance of Jewelry Storage
In the world of **jewelry**, an organized cabinet is not just about aesthetics; it’s about ensuring your precious items are protected and easily accessible. **Jewelry cabinets** serve as a sanctuary for our cherished accessories, but without proper organization, they can quickly turn into chaotic storage spaces. This is where the role of **velvet lined drawers** comes into play. With their luxurious feel and protective qualities, these drawers not only enhance the visual appeal but also safeguard your jewelry from damage.

Why Choose Velvet Lined Drawers for Your Jewelry Cabinet?
Velvet lined drawers are not merely a luxury; they serve several practical functions that elevate your jewelry storage experience. First and foremost, the **soft texture** of velvet cushions your jewelry, preventing scratches and tarnishing. **Velvet** also absorbs moisture, which can be particularly beneficial in humid climates where jewelry is susceptible to oxidization.
Furthermore, the elegant appearance of velvet enhances the overall look of any jewelry cabinet. It creates a sense of luxury and sophistication, making it a perfect choice for anyone looking to elevate their décor. By opting for velvet lined drawers, you are making an investment in both the protection and presentation of your jewelry collection.
Benefits of Velvet Lining in Jewelry Storage
The benefits of using velvet as a lining material extend beyond just aesthetics. Here are several key advantages that make velvet-lined drawers a preferred choice:
1. Protection Against Scratches
Jewelry is often delicate and prone to scratches. The soft fabric of velvet provides a protective barrier, ensuring that each piece remains pristine and free from damage.
2. Moisture Control
Unlike other materials, velvet has moisture-absorbing properties, which can help prevent tarnishing and corrosion. This is particularly vital for metals and gemstones that are sensitive to humidity.
3. Aesthetic Appeal
The luxurious look of velvet can enhance the visual appeal of your jewelry cabinet. It adds an element of sophistication and elegance, transforming a simple storage solution into a statement piece.
4. Easy Organization
Velvet lined drawers can be customized with compartments and inserts, making it easy to organize different types of jewelry. This ensures that items are not only easy to find but also kept safe from tangling or rubbing against each other.
5. Versatility
Whether you have a vast collection of jewelry or just a few cherished pieces, velvet lined drawers can be tailored to suit your needs. They accommodate various types of jewelry, including rings, necklaces, and earrings, providing a versatile storage solution.
How to Effectively Organize Your Jewelry Cabinet
An organized jewelry cabinet not only looks appealing but also makes it easier to find what you need. Here are some effective strategies to maximize your jewelry cabinet's organization:
1. Sort by Type
Begin by sorting your jewelry into categories: necklaces, bracelets, earrings, and rings. This will help you determine how much space you need for each type and make it easier to find specific pieces.
2. Use Velvet Lined Inserts
Invest in velvet lined inserts that can be placed within your drawers. These can include compartments for rings, slots for necklaces, and trays for earrings. Using inserts helps keep everything in its place and prevents items from becoming tangled.
3. Utilize Vertical Space
Consider vertical organizers for necklaces to keep them from tangling. Hanging them on hooks or using tiered trays can free up drawer space while keeping your jewelry easily accessible.
4. Regularly Rotate and Clean
Making it a habit to clean and rotate your jewelry not only keeps it looking fresh but can also alert you to pieces that may need repair or polishing. Regular upkeep ensures that your collection remains in the best condition.
5. Keep Frequently Worn Items Accessible
Designate a section of your cabinet for frequently worn items. By having these pieces easily accessible, you can save time when getting ready.
Different Types of Jewelry Storage Solutions
There are various storage solutions available for jewelry enthusiasts. Understanding these options can help you choose what works best for your collection:
1. Jewelry Boxes
Traditional jewelry boxes come in various sizes, often featuring multiple compartments. They can be lined with velvet, providing both protection and style.
2. Drawer Organizers
If you have a larger collection, drawer organizers are an excellent choice. These can be built into your existing drawers, maximizing space while keeping pieces organized.
3. Wall-Mounted Displays
For those who want to showcase their jewelry, wall-mounted displays are a fantastic option. They not only display your jewelry but also keep it easily accessible.
4. Travel Cases
For individuals who travel frequently, a jewelry travel case is essential. Look for cases with velvet lining to ensure your jewelry is protected while on the go.
Using Velvet Drawer Inserts for Maximum Protection
To further enhance the organization of your jewelry cabinet, consider using **velvet drawer inserts**. These specially designed compartments can help you maintain order while providing additional protection for your items.
1. Customization Options
Many brands offer customizable velvet inserts, allowing you to design a layout that fits your specific needs. You can choose the size and number of compartments to best suit your collection.
2. Preventing Damage
By using inserts, you create a cushion for your jewelry, reducing the risk of scratching and abrasion that can occur when items rub against each other.
3. Easy Accessibility
With everything neatly organized into compartments, you can quickly locate the piece you want without rummaging through a cluttered drawer.
Maintenance and Care for Velvet Lined Drawers
While velvet lined drawers are a beautiful addition to your jewelry cabinet, they do require some care to ensure they remain in excellent condition. Here are some maintenance tips:
1. Regular Cleaning
Dust and debris can accumulate in your drawers.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e down the velvet lining regularly. For deeper cleaning, consider using a vacuum with a soft brush attachment to gently remove dirt.
2. Avoid Moisture
Although velvet absorbs moisture, too much can lead to mold or mildew. Ensure your jewelry cabinet is stored in a dry environment, and avoid placing damp items inside.
3. Preventing Stains
Be cautious with products such as perfumes and lotions that can stain velvet. Allow your jewelry to dry completely after wearing before returning it to the cabinet.
4. Protecting from Sunlight
Direct sunlight can fade velvet over time. Ensure your jewelry cabinet is placed away from direct light to maintain its rich color and texture.
Creative Ideas for Displaying Jewelry in Your Cabinet
If you want to make your jewelry cabinet a focal point in your room, consider these creative display ideas:
1. Layering Techniques
Use layering techniques with velvet trays to create depth and interest. Place shorter items in front and longer pieces at the back to ensure visibility.
2. Color Coordination
Organize your jewelry by color to create a visually striking display. This adds a beautiful aesthetic and makes it easier to find pieces that match your outfit.
3. Incorporating Decorative Elements
Incorporate decorative elements like mirrors or small plants within your jewelry cabinet. This can enhance the overall look and create a more inviting space.
4. Seasonal Displays
Consider changing your displays based on seasons or occasions. Rotate your jewelry collection to highlight different styles and colors throughout the year.

FAQs
1. How often should I clean my velvet lined drawers?
It is recommended to clean your velvet lined drawers every few months to remove dust and debris, ensuring your jewelry remains in a clean environment.
2. Can I use any type of velvet for my jewelry cabinet?
While all velvet may provide some level of protection, look for high-quality velvet that is specifically designed for jewelry storage to ensure durability and moisture absorption.
3. How do I prevent my jewelry from tarnishing?
Store your jewelry in a dry environment, use anti-tarnish strips, and consider using velvet lined drawers to absorb excess moisture.
4. Are velvet lined drawers suitable for all types of jewelry?
Yes, velvet lined drawers are suitable for all types of jewelry, including rings, necklaces, earrings, and bracelets, providing a safe and elegant storage solution.
5. What should I do if my velvet lining gets stained?
For minor stains, gently blot the area with a soft, damp cloth. For tougher stains, consult a professional cleaner who specializes in fabric care.
